LLMAG: Where are you from? Chris: Charlotte, North Carolina What side of town where you raised on? Chris: I am from Fourth Ward. There is no Fourth Ward as we knew it back then. It was on the four corners of the Square. First Ward, Second Ward, Third Ward and Fourth Ward, I lived in one of those Wards. Why did you start carving? Well I’ve always been an artist I’ve always drawn. As a young boy, when I went to school I thought everybody knew how to draw. No one taught it to me. So it was something I thought everybody could do. When I realized that everyone couldn’t, that’s when I thought…I might have a little talent here. You know. So why do u carve sticks? It’s not like I’m carving the sticks, The sticks are dictating to me what they are. It’s like an exchange

of my time to the natural development of the trees. I don’t know… It’s like some kind of connection, like the internet or something I don’t know. They can tell me who they are. It’s characters between all trees. So, where do you hope to go with carving the sticks? Do you want to potentially sell them? Or do you just want to carve because it’s your artistry and it’s a talent that you have? I want to market the ideas. I don’t really want to sell the sticks, but I want to sell the characters that I communicate from the sticks, so that the characters can be transferred over to cards, jewelry or glass… you know whatever. That one carving takes me hours and hours to do. I wanted it to be my income basically. If I had it as my income I would never go unemployed again. Tell me about some of the sticks and what some of them mean. I have one from my biblical background, it’s an Adam and Eve episode. The lady is on top of the

serpent and the man is at the bottom holding an apple. Like nothing can come between us but the serpent. I’m trying to tell that story because a lot of people don’t know it. See allot of people don’t read the book. And they don’t know the story so, I have to find another meaning to bring the same idea to peo-ple. I found carving to be one of them and if that’s my Pulpit then am going to stand and do my thing. How can people contact you? You can find me on Belmont Ave. and through Local Looks Magazine. Do you have any final comments or shot- outs? Not really. All I want is you people to realize is that there are some great things right under your noses, all you really have to do is listen and observe. The real shot-out is to this magazine for giving me the chance to tell this story. It’s good that someone who came from this place has grown up to realize that there are allot of talent individuals here.

LLM: Where are you from? Dream: Columbia, SC What do you love most about your city? The nightlife, we party hard in the Met. When did you start your rap career? When I was 15 I started rapping and I wanted it to be my career years later. What "rap" name do you go by and how did you get that name? The Group name is monopoly I got the name Dream be-cause I think and sleep a lot. LOL What are most of your lyrics about? Life experiences the struggle and the pleasure. Do you have any major influences? Jay-Z, Nas, Scarface, Biggie and 2pac Describe yourself in 3 words. Cool, Fly and handsome at least that's what my mother says. Where do you plan to be with this career in the next 5 years? RICH!! LOL, or well off hopefully. Any shot-outs or last comments?

Monopoly teamowners ENT. and Mastermind records.
